Overview
Traditional Sweet Sorghum is an early-maturing, heirloom variety prized for its sweet, juicy stalks and remarkable versatility. Developed over generations for resilience and flavor, this fast-growing crop thrives under minimal management and adapts well to diverse growing conditions. The stems are rich in fermentable sugars and packed with essential nutrients including iron, calcium, phosphorus, and multiple vitamins. Beyond fresh consumption, Traditional Sweet Sorghum serves as a valuable feedstock for sugar production, spirits, bioethanol, paper manufacturing, and animal forage—making it one of the most multifunctional cash crops available.

Cultivation Guidelines
Traditional Sweet Sorghum performs best in well-drained loamy soil with full sun exposure. Direct sow after the last frost when soil temperature reaches above 15°C. Thin seedlings to maintain proper spacing (approx. 20–30 cm apart) for optimal stalk development. Drought-tolerant once established, yet responds well to moderate irrigation during jointing and booting stages. Minimal fertilization required—apply compost or balanced fertilizer at planting and top-dress before stem elongation. Harvest when seeds reach dough stage for maximum sugar content. Suitable for both small garden plots and field-scale production.
